		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hey, the auto-log feature is very useful. I thought you would like to use that.</p>
<p>All my putty sessions are automatically logged to an encrypted directory on my work PC.</p>
<p>My auto-log feature creates a  new log file for each session, based on year-month-day-hour-minute-hostname.</p>
<p>I don&#8217;t even worry about creating chunks of text for documenting. I simply work then I open the log to write emails and stuff.</p>

		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Serial settings:  Turn off flow control.  Cisco serial terminals don&#8217;t use it and that&#8217;s about 95% of the my use of the serial port. </p>
<p>I also change the color of the font to a bright yellow or green and increase the size of the font to make it more readable.  Not just to me, but a lot of times I am asking someone to watch over my shoulder.</p>
